What is ETH Staking?
Previously, Ethereum relied on Proof-of-Work (PoW), where miners solved complex puzzles to validate transactions. PoS replaces this with validators who “stake” their ETH – essentially locking it up as collateral – to have a chance to propose and validate new blocks. Validators earn rewards for their service, distributed in ETH. The minimum staking requirement is 32 ETH, but alternatives exist (discussed below).
Ways to Stake ETH
- Solo Staking (32 ETH): Requires technical expertise to run a validator node. Offers the highest rewards but also the greatest responsibility.
- Pooled Staking: Joining a staking pool allows users with less than 32 ETH to participate. Popular providers include Lido, Rocket Pool, and StakeWise. Fees are charged by the pool operator.
- Centralized Exchanges: Exchanges like Coinbase, Kraken, and Binance offer staking services. Convenient but involve counterparty risk – you trust the exchange to manage your ETH;

Factors Affecting APR
- Network Participation: More stakers generally mean lower rewards per validator.
- ETH Price: Rewards are paid in ETH, so price fluctuations impact your returns.
- Staking Provider Fees: Pooled staking and exchange staking involve fees that reduce your net APR.
- Slashing Risks: Validators can be penalized (slashed) for misbehavior, reducing their stake.
Risks of ETH Staking
While potentially lucrative, ETH staking isn’t without risks:
- Lock-up Period: Withdrawing staked ETH can take time (currently, withdrawals are fully enabled, but were previously restricted).
- Slashing: Incorrect validator operation can lead to penalties.
- Smart Contract Risk: Pooled staking relies on smart contracts, which are vulnerable to bugs or exploits.
- Exchange Risk: Centralized exchange staking carries the risk of exchange insolvency or security breaches.
Liquid Staking Derivatives (LSDs)
LSDs, like stETH (Lido) and rETH (Rocket Pool), represent your staked ETH and can be used in DeFi applications while your ETH remains staked. This allows you to earn additional yield. However, they introduce additional complexities and risks.
